What ThreatSight Does
ThreatSight is an AI-powered outdoor surveillance platform that detects firearms, bladed weapons, and threatening behavior in the approach zone around protected locations — giving security teams and law enforcement 2–5 minutes of advance warning before a threat reaches a building.

System Requirements
Integration Requirements
- ✓ Existing outdoor IP cameras (RTSP/HLS)
- ✓ Standard internet connection (min 5 Mbps upload)
- ✓ Web browser for alert dashboard
- ✓ Optional: existing PSIM/SIEM integrations
Detection Capabilities
- ✓ Firearms — visible and partially obscured
- ✓ Bladed weapons — knives, blades
- ✓ Threatening approach patterns
- ✓ Weapon classification by type
